How does contract administration ensure alignment between design intent and construction?

Explanation:
Contract administration keeps design intent aligned with construction by actively verifying and guiding work throughout the build, not just at the end. Submittals review checks shop drawings, product data, and samples against the contract documents so what is manufactured and installed matches the specified requirements before it goes in place. RFIs provide a formal way to clarify any ambiguities in the design or site conditions, preventing interpretations that could drift from the intended outcome. Approvals ensure that proposed installations meet the designer’s criteria before proceeding. Regular site observations by architects or engineers are key, as they observe the actual work in progress to confirm it conforms to drawings and specs and to catch issues early. Conformance with contract documents then involves documenting compliance, addressing deviations, and guiding any necessary changes through approved processes to maintain alignment between what was designed and what is built.
